Quizon edges Frayna, remains unbeaten in National Chess Championship


International Master Daniel Quizon edged Woman Grandmaster Janelle May Frayna to tighten his grip on the top spot after four rounds in the 2021 National Chess Championship at the Solea Hotel and Resort in Mactan, Cebu Saturday.

The 17-year-old Quizon needed 57 moves of a King’s Indian Defense to outlast Frayna and remain unscathed with four wins in this 11-round tournament.

He was gunning for his fifth straight triumph against GM Joey Antonio at press time.

Breathing down Quizon’s neck was International Master Ricky de Guzman after prevailing top seed International Master Paulo Bersamina in 72 moves of a Queen’s Gambit.

De Guzman, the oldest among 12 participants at 60 years old, hiked his tally to 3.5 points following previous victories over IM Joel Pimentel and IM Michael Concio Jr.

Other fourth round results saw GM Joey Antonio drawing with IM John Marvin Miciano in 39 moves of a Petroff Defense, IM Ronald Dableo splitting the point with Concio in 31 moves of a Pirc Defense, and Laylo and Pimentel agreeing to a truce in 30 moves of a Gruenfeld duel.
